Transaction 05123553faf3887aa1237847c80997266aca4c240e37bbc3520d1dd659d7f4e2

1 Input
2 Outputs
  • 05123553faf3887aa1237847c80997266aca4c240e37bbc3520d1dd659d7f4e2:0
  • value  3065760
    address  18XX44waCA7xfe9rSojsHvJKmKHmUDPQ2d
  • 05123553faf3887aa1237847c80997266aca4c240e37bbc3520d1dd659d7f4e2:1
  • value  7028197
    address  19pVmny22yctSFM8RgkWKfSUx7bk5ceWLG